The victim of fatal gunfire late one night this week is a 17-year-old Minneapolis boy who was shot in the chest, authorities said.
Maurice O. Brown was shot late Tuesday, and his body was found outside in the 2200 block of 13th Avenue South, according to the Hennepin County medical examiner's office.
There had been no arrests as of Thursday in the killing, which police have said was not a random act.
Shot-detection technology alerted police to the gunfire.
